Hazardous to the aquatic environment, chronic category 3
Harmful to aquatic life with long lasting effects.
Other hazards :
Not classified
2.2. Label elements
Labelling according to Regulation (EC) No 1272/2008
None
Hazard pictogram(s):
Signal word:
Warning
Hazard statement(s):
H400 : Very toxic to aquatic life.
H412 : Harmful to aquatic life with long lasting effects.
P273 : Avoid release to the environment.
P391 : Collect spillage.
P501-2 : Dispose of contents/container to an authorised waste collection point.
2.3. Other hazards
None

SECTION 4: First aid measures
4.1. Description of first aid measures
Contact with eyes :
If substance has got into eyes, immediately wash out with plenty of water for
several minutes
Seek medical attention if irritation persists
